re PR target/52624 (missing __builtin_bswap16)
PR target/52624
* doc/extend.texi (Other Builtins): Document __builtin_bswap16.
(PowerPC AltiVec/VSX Built-in Functions): Remove it.
* doc/md.texi (Standard Names): Add bswap.
* builtin-types.def (BT_UINT16): New primitive type.
(BT_FN_UINT16_UINT16): New function type.
* builtins.def (BUILT_IN_BSWAP16): New.
* builtins.c (expand_builtin_bswap): Add TARGET_MODE argument.
(expand_builtin) <BUILT_IN_BSWAP16>: New case. Pass TARGET_MODE to
expand_builtin_bswap.
(fold_builtin_bswap): Add BUILT_IN_BSWAP16 case.
(fold_builtin_1): Likewise.
(is_inexpensive_builtin): Likewise.
* optabs.c (expand_unop): Deal with bswap in HImode specially. Add
missing bits for bswap to libcall code.
* tree.c (build_common_tree_nodes): Build uint16_type_node.
* tree.h (enum tree_index): Add TI_UINT16_TYPE.
(uint16_type_node): New define.
* config/rs6000/rs6000-builtin.def (RS6000_BUILTIN_BSWAP_HI): Delete.
* config/rs6000/rs6000.c (rs6000_expand_builtin): Remove handling of
above builtin.
(rs6000_init_builtins): Likewise.
* config/rs6000/rs6000.md (bswaphi2): Add TARGET_POWERPC predicate.
c-family/
* c-common.h (uint16_type_node): Rename into...
(c_uint16_type_node): ...this.
* c-common.c (c_common_nodes_and_builtins): Adjust for above renaming.
* c-cppbuiltin.c (builtin_define_stdint_macros): Likewise.
From-SVN: r186308
